However, from a corporate and personal perspective, I ask each team member (especially myself) to attempt to follow one simple rule each day.

 

Do to others, as you would have them do to you.

 

Simple enough, right? Walk in the other person’s shoes. Change sides, how would you want to be treated? Stop, gain perspective and seek out wisdom like it is a hidden treasure. Fast forward and think about the implications of your actions. Unfortunately, it is not as easy as it sounds.

 

This simple principle is found in the Bible in two locations (Matthew 7:12 and Luke 6:31). Also, it is popularly referred to as the “Golden Rule”. It is not easy to live by and I work at it everyday. It is a constant reminder of what we (as people in this world) should strive for today. Ironically enough they are all principles and teachings from Christ:
